Want to know what a Windows Live Platform Quick Application (Beta) is (other than another great snappy name from Microsoft's PR people)? Well if you do, check out the link below.
"Windows Live Web services are an ideal platform for developers. They offer a deep level of control with access to core services and data through open application programming interfaces (APIs)."
Windows Live - QuickApps